# parser.py | |
import ast | |
def get_category(node): | |
"""Determine the category of an AST node.""" | |
if isinstance(node, (ast.Import, ast.ImportFrom)): | |
return 'import' | |
elif isinstance(node, (ast.Assign, ast.AnnAssign, ast.AugAssign)): | |
return 'assignment' | |
elif isinstance(node, ast.FunctionDef): | |
return 'function' | |
elif isinstance(node, ast.AsyncFunctionDef): | |
return 'async_function' | |
elif isinstance(node, ast.ClassDef): | |
return 'class' | |
elif isinstance(node, ast.Expr): | |
return 'expression' | |
else: | |
return 'other' | |
def parse_node(node, lines, prev_end, level=0): | |
"""Recursively parse an AST node and its children, assigning hierarchy levels.""" | |
parts = [] | |
start_line = getattr(node, 'lineno', prev_end + 1) | |
end_line = getattr(node, 'end_lineno', start_line) | |
# Handle spacers before the node | |
if start_line > prev_end + 1: | |
spacer_lines = lines[prev_end:start_line - 1] | |
parts.append({ | |
'category': 'spacer', | |
'source': ''.join(spacer_lines), | |
'location': (prev_end + 1, start_line - 1), | |
'level': level | |
}) | |
# Capture the node's source | |
stmt_lines = lines[start_line - 1:end_line] | |
parts.append({ | |
'category': get_category(node), | |
'source': ''.join(stmt_lines), | |
'location': (start_line, end_line), | |
'level': level | |
}) | |
# Process nested nodes (e.g., class or function bodies) | |
if hasattr(node, 'body'): | |
nested_prev_end = end_line - 1 | |
for child in node.body: | |
child_parts = parse_node(child, lines, nested_prev_end, level + 1) | |
parts.extend(child_parts) | |
nested_prev_end = child_parts[-1]['location'][1] | |
return parts | |
def parse_python_code(code): | |
"""Parse Python code string and return parts with hierarchy.""" | |
lines = code.splitlines(keepends=True) | |
try: | |
tree = ast.parse(code) | |
except SyntaxError: | |
return [{'category': 'error', 'source': 'Invalid Python code', 'location': (1, 1), 'level': 0}] | |
parts = [] | |
prev_end = 0 | |
for stmt in tree.body: | |
stmt_parts = parse_node(stmt, lines, prev_end) | |
parts.extend(stmt_parts) | |
prev_end = stmt_parts[-1]['location'][1] | |
# Capture trailing spacers | |
if prev_end < len(lines): | |
remaining_lines = lines[prev_end:] | |
parts.append({ | |
'category': 'spacer', | |
'source': ''.join(remaining_lines), | |
'location': (prev_end + 1, len(lines) + 1), | |
'level': 0 | |
}) | |
return parts |
